电科金仓KingbaseES:国产数据库的自主创新之路
2025.09.19 10:43浏览量:0简介:本文深度解析电科金仓KingbaseES数据库的技术架构与创新突破,从国产化替代、高可用设计、智能优化到行业应用场景,展现其如何通过自主可控技术推动国产数据库崛起,为企业提供安全、高效、智能的数据库解决方案。
一、国产数据库的崛起背景:从“可用”到“好用”的跨越
在全球数据库市场长期被Oracle、MySQL等国际巨头主导的背景下,国产数据库的崛起既是技术自主可控的战略需求,也是数字化转型浪潮下的必然选择。电科金仓作为中国电子科技集团(CETC)旗下核心企业,其自主研发的KingbaseES数据库(以下简称“KES”)凭借“全栈自主可控、高性能、高安全”的特性,成为国产数据库的标杆产品。
1.1 国产化替代的迫切性
近年来,国际形势复杂多变,数据安全与供应链安全成为企业关注的焦点。金融、能源、政务等关键行业对数据库的自主可控需求日益迫切。KES通过全栈国产化适配(如鲲鹏、飞腾、龙芯等CPU,统信UOS、麒麟等操作系统),实现了从硬件到软件的完全自主可控,有效降低了“卡脖子”风险。
1.2 技术演进路径:从跟随到创新
早期国产数据库多以开源产品(如PostgreSQL、MySQL)为基础进行二次开发,但KES选择了一条更艰难的路径——基于自主架构设计,同时吸收开源生态的优秀实践。例如,KES兼容PostgreSQL协议,降低了用户迁移成本,但在内核层面实现了事务处理、并发控制等核心模块的完全重构。
二、KingbaseES的技术创新:四大核心优势解析
2.1 高可用与灾备设计:满足企业级严苛需求
KES通过多副本同步、主备切换、分布式集群等技术,实现了99.999%的可用性保障。其核心创新点包括:
- 三节点强一致架构:采用Paxos协议实现数据多副本强一致,避免脑裂问题。
- 智能故障检测:基于心跳机制和AI预测模型,提前感知节点异常并触发自动切换。
- 跨数据中心容灾:支持两地三中心部署,RPO(恢复点目标)趋近于0。
代码示例:高可用配置片段
-- 配置主备同步模式
ALTER SYSTEM SET synchronous_commit = 'remote_write';
-- 启用自动故障转移
ALTER SYSTEM SET failover_mode = 'automatic';
2.2 性能优化:从SQL解析到执行计划的深度调优
KES针对中国企业的复杂查询场景(如多表关联、聚合计算),在SQL引擎层面进行了深度优化:
- 自适应查询优化:基于成本模型动态选择执行计划,避免“计划错选”问题。
- 向量化执行引擎:将批量数据操作转换为SIMD指令,提升CPU利用率。
- 智能索引推荐:通过机器学习分析查询模式,自动建议缺失索引。
性能对比数据:在TPC-C基准测试中,KES 9.6版本相比8.0版本吞吐量提升40%,延迟降低60%。
2.3 安全合规:满足等保2.0与国密要求
KES内置了国密SM2/SM3/SM4算法,支持透明数据加密(TDE)、细粒度权限控制、审计日志全量留存等功能。其安全设计符合等保2.0三级要求,并通过了公安部信息安全产品检测中心认证。
安全配置示例
-- 启用透明数据加密
CREATE ENCRYPTION KEY my_key WITH ALGORITHM 'SM4';
ALTER TABLE sensitive_data ENABLE ENCRYPTION WITH KEY my_key;
2.4 智能化运维:AI驱动的数据库自治
KES通过集成AI引擎,实现了参数自动调优、异常检测、容量预测等自治能力。例如,其“智能压测”功能可模拟真实业务负载,自动生成优化建议。
三、行业应用场景:从政务到金融的深度实践
3.1 政务领域:一网通办与数据共享
KES支撑了多个省级“一网通办”平台,其多租户架构和行级安全控制,确保了不同部门数据的隔离与共享。例如,某省政务平台通过KES实现了100+业务系统的统一数据管理,查询响应时间从秒级降至毫秒级。
3.2 金融行业:核心系统国产化替代
某国有银行将核心交易系统从Oracle迁移至KES,通过分库分表和读写分离技术,实现了每日亿级交易量的平稳运行。迁移后,TCO(总拥有成本)降低35%,故障恢复时间从小时级缩短至分钟级。
3.3 能源行业:物联网时序数据处理
KES针对工业物联网场景优化了时序数据存储引擎,支持每秒百万级数据点的写入与聚合查询。某电网公司通过KES构建了设备状态监测平台,故障预测准确率提升20%。
四、开发者与企业的实践建议
4.1 迁移策略:分阶段推进
- 试点阶段:选择非核心系统(如测试环境、报表系统)进行验证。
- 兼容层适配:利用KES的PostgreSQL兼容性,减少SQL重写工作量。
- 性能基准测试:使用HammerDB等工具对比迁移前后的TPS/QPS指标。
4.2 运维优化:从被动到主动
- 监控体系构建:集成Prometheus+Grafana,实时监控连接数、缓存命中率等关键指标。
- 慢查询治理:通过
EXPLAIN ANALYZE
定位瓶颈,结合索引优化手册进行调优。 - 容灾演练:每季度模拟主备切换、数据中心故障,验证高可用方案的有效性。
4.3 生态合作:融入国产化技术栈
KES已与500+国产软硬件完成适配,建议企业优先选择已通过认证的中间件(如东方通、普元)、芯片(如鲲鹏920)和操作系统(如统信UOS),降低集成风险。
五、未来展望:走向全球的国产数据库
电科金仓正通过“云原生+AI”双轮驱动,推动KES向分布式、智能化方向演进。其最新版本已支持Serverless架构,可按需弹性扩展;同时,与昇腾AI芯片的深度整合,将使复杂查询的推理速度提升10倍以上。
国产数据库的崛起,不仅是技术层面的突破,更是中国数字经济底层基础设施自主可控的关键一步。电科金仓KingbaseES的实践证明,通过持续创新与生态共建,国产数据库完全有能力在全球市场中占据一席之地。
发表评论
登录后可评论,请前往 登录 或 注册